## Idempotency Keys for Payment Retries (Lumopay)

Every retry of a charge request must reuse the original idempotency key; generating a new key on retry can produce duplicate charges. Keys are scoped per merchant and expire after 48 hours. Reviewers should verify keys are derived server-side, never from client input. The full key-generation specification and threat model are maintained on the internal page.

dashboard of kaguf-tawip = https://vault.merlaqsys.test/issue

# Break-Glass: Catalog Cache Invalidation

Scope: the Pinrow product catalog at Veldstone Retail. If stale prices persist after a purge and the Hollowmere invalidation queue is wedged, use break-glass to flush the edge tier directly. Contractors: get verbal sign-off from the catalog lead first. Steps: open the Hollowmere admin shell, select emergency-flush, confirm the tenant, and run it once — repeated flushes thrash the origin. Access is logged and expires after 20 minutes. Unseal the admin shell with the passphrase below.

recovery phrase for kahop-tajog: istix-casvan

Step 4: Upgrading Quillbus from 3.x to 4.0. Heads up — the broker won't accept old-format acks after the switch, so drain the Fernwick queues first. Run the drain script, wait for zero in-flight messages, then flip the version flag. Before restarting consumers, point the offset tracker at the primary store using the connection string below.

replica DSN, fadup-yagug: mssql://rusox_svc:0K2wrVJefbkR2n@db-53b3.qirvangrid.example:5432/istix

## Ownership

The Wrenbox shared component library follows strict semver. Support team: never advise customers to pin to `latest`; minor bumps can change styling tokens. Breaking changes ship only in majors with a two-week deprecation notice. Release notes live in `CHANGELOG.md`. Version disputes and hotfix requests are handled by the maintainer listed below.

account owner for bawip-tahag: Raleth Quenok